Today's featured Etsy shop... Frosted So Sweet

My name is Cassandra and my Etsy shop is Frosted So Sweet.

When did you start your Etsy shop?
I opened my shop in August 2012. Beforehand, I sold my items in my mom’s shop, EmsJewelry.

What is the story behind your business name?
Frost Me Sweet, a bistro in my hometown, is one of my favorite places to get a sandwich and some lemonade. They make really cute and delicious cupcakes, too, and this inspired the name for my shop.

What do you sell?
I sell polymer clay miniature food jewelry, mostly earrings. Cupcakes, pickles, bomb pops, carrots—you name it. I also sell handmade scrunchies, colorful gumball earrings, bracelets, and shrink plastic stud earrings with animals character illustrations.

How did you get into your craft?
My mom is a very crafty person, so I grew up in a creative environment. I first started using polymer clay three years ago after my mom purchased a miniature food instruction book for me.

Anything else you would like to share?
I recently graduated with a BA in English writing. I also enjoy drawing animals.
